Об альбоме (сборнике)
Lynne Arriale's first ever live CD-DVD set. This premium double disc package features 5.1 surround sound mixes of European BR-Alpha Television's broadcast of Arriale's triumphant performance at Burghausen Jazz Week, April 14, 2005. The DVD also features the award-winning Royal Stewart Entertainment documentary Lynne Arriale: Profile of a Performing Artist, broadcast nation-wide on PBS & NPR stations.
